What did Marie Curie invent?
Marie Curie, a name that resonates through the halls of science and innovation, was a pioneering physicist and chemist known for her groundbreaking work in radioactivity. Her contributions to science were not just significant; they were revolutionary. Born in Warsaw, Poland, as Maria Skłodowska in 1867, Curies journey into the world of science was marked by passion and relentless determination. She became the first woman to win a Nobel Prize and remains the only person to win Nobel Prizes in two different scientific fields: Physics in 1903 and Chemistry in 1911. Curies work laid the foundation for many advancements in medical science and physics, particularly in the treatment of cancer and the understanding of atomic behavior.
One of her most remarkable achievements was the discovery of the elements polonium and radium. Working alongside her husband, Pierre Curie, they isolated these radioactive elements from uranium ore. Their research not only highlighted the properties of radioactivity but also opened the door for subsequent studies into nuclear physics and chemistry. The isolation of radium, in particular, was pivotal. Radiums ability to emit radiation made it a valuable resource in medical treatments, especially for cancer. In fact, radium was used in early radiation therapies to target and kill cancerous cells, a practice that is still evolving today.
Curies work with radioactivity did not stop at discovery. She developed methods for measuring radioactivity and even created a portable X-ray machine during World War I. This innovative device, known as the Little Curie, was used to help treat wounded soldiers on the battlefield by providing immediate X-ray imaging. The impact of her inventions was profound, as it not only facilitated medical diagnosis but also made life-saving treatments more accessible during a time of war.
Additionally, Curies research contributed to the understanding of radiation safety. She recognized the potential dangers of radiation exposure long before it became a public concern. Her work laid the groundwork for safety protocols and regulations that protect workers in laboratories and medical settings where radioactive materials are used. This foresight was crucial in establishing standards that remain in place to this day, ensuring the safety of individuals who work with these powerful materials.
Curies legacy extends beyond her inventions and discoveries. She was a trailblazer for women in science, breaking barriers in a male-dominated field. Her dedication and passion for science inspired countless women to pursue careers in STEM (science, technology, engineering, and mathematics). The Marie Curie Actions, part of the EUs research and innovation program, are named in her honor, promoting research opportunities for young scientists across Europe.
In terms of her impact on public health, Curies research has had lasting effects. The development of radiotherapy as a standard treatment for cancer owes much to her pioneering work. Organizations today continue to build upon her findings. For example, hospitals and research institutions focus on improving cancer treatments through innovative technologies and methodologies inspired by Curies early discoveries.
